EVALUATION 4 - History
• Intoxicated patients can be unreliable historians
• 70% of intentional overdoses involve more than 1 substance
• Always consider substances which patients may not think are harmful
examples: aspirin, paracetamol, antihistamines

PREVENTION OF POISON ABSORPTION
‘Decontamination’
Note - staff may be at risk
5 YR TOXICOLOGY 2003 28
DECONTAMINATION 1• Skin
• Remove contaminated clothing / wash skin
• Gastrointestinal Activated charcoal (in 1st hour post
ingestion)x Emesis (‘ipecac’ ) – rarely usedx Gastric lavage – rarely used Cathartics / whole bowel irrigation
• Eyes
5 YR TOXICOLOGY 2003 29
DECONTAMINATION 2- activated charcoal
• 1 gram / kg• Does not absorb
– Lithium– Heavy metals - iron– Alcohols/Solvents/
hydrocarbons– Caustics/strong acids– Cyanide– Pesticides
• Recovers 60% of poison if administered within the first hour
5 YR TOXICOLOGY 2003 30
DECONTAMINATION 3- cathartics
• Reduced gastrointestinal transit time => reduced time for drug absorption
• Osmotic agents – sorbitol, mannitol, MgSO4
• Contraindications – ileus / bowel obstruction– electrolyte imbalance
• Indication = debatible
5 YR TOXICOLOGY 2003 31
DECONTAMINATION 4-whole bowel irrigation
• May be useful for concretions &sustained-release preparations
• Polyethylene-glycol solution
• Administer at 1000 mls/hour until effluent is clear
• Rarely done but may be life saving if SR overdose

ANTIDOTES
• Useful in < 5% of overdoses
• Know which antidotes are stocked
• Know how to get advice
5 YR TOXICOLOGY 2003 33
ANTIDOTES – some examples
Poison1. Paracetamol2. Narcotics3. Oral anticoagulants4. Carbon monoxide5. Organophosphates6. Betablockers7. Ca channel blockers8. Iron 9. Digoxin10. Methanol, ethylene glycol11. Cyanide
Antidote1. N-acetyl cysteine2. Naloxone3. FFP, Vitamin K4. oxygen5. Atropine, oximes6. Glucagon, insulin/glucose7. Calcium8. Desferrioxamine9. Digoxin Fab fragments10. ethanol, fomepizole11. Vit. B12, E-L kit,
Kelocyanor
5 YR TOXICOLOGY 2003 34
ENHANCEMENT OF ELIMINATION
1. Diuresis2. Multiple-dose activated charcoal3. Urinary pH manipulation
- salicylate4. Haemodialysis
- small molecules, low protein binding - e.g. salicylate, Lithium
5. Charcoal haemoperfusion- theophylline/barbiturates/carbamazepine

MONITORING
• Clinical observation– i.e. neurological assessments
• Pulse oximetry
• ECG monitoring– Minimum 6 hours if cardio-active drug– >24 hours if delayed release
preparation
